Jax State Adds Osborne as Cross Country, Track & Field Assistant

JACKSONVILLE – Just two weeks removed from adding Kevin Kean as an assistant, Jeremy Provence has added Noah Osborne to the Cross Country and Track & Field staffs as an assistant coach.

"We are thrilled to welcome Noah to the Gamecock family," said Provence, "Noah comes to us highly recommended by those who have worked with him."

Most recently, Osborne served as a track & field graduate assistant at Southeastern University, where he helped the Fire to have three individuals take home outdoor conference championships.

"In his short time as a Graduate Assistant at Southeastern, Noah made an immediate impact helping guide multiple conference champions and national qualifiers," said Provence, "Noah was described as someone who values building relationships, a high-level recruiter with connections throughout the southeast, and has an incredible work ethic."

Osborne also served as the Head Strength & Conditioning Coach, Head Track & Field Coach and Assistant Athletic Director at Bradenton Christian High School as well as a Strength & Conditioning Coach at D1 Lakewood Ranch in Sarasota, Fla.

"Noah will primarily work with the sprints, hurdles, and jumps event groups," said Provence.

Osborne graduated from Samford University with his Bachelor's and from Southeastern University with his Master's.
